** The Mercedes-Benz repair market for Holden, Louisiana, is entirely served by providers in Baton Rouge, located approximately 15-25 miles away. There are no dedicated Mercedes-Benz specialists physically located within Holden itself. The market in the greater Baton Rouge area is competitive and of high quality, featuring a clear choice between the factory-backed dealership and several highly competent independent specialists. **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, with independents competing directly with the dealership on technical expertise, often at a 20-40% lower labor rate. Customers choose based on their priority: the absolute certainty of the dealership or the cost savings and personalized service of an independent. **Competition Level:** The market is robust with a few key players dominating the "German auto" niche. This competition benefits the consumer, driving high service standards and specialization.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are consistent with luxury automotive service. The dealership typically commands the highest rate ($180-$220/hr), while top-tier independents range from $130-$170/hr. Parts costs can be significantly lower at independents who use high-quality aftermarket or rebuilt components, whereas the dealer exclusively uses OEM parts. A major service or repair (e.g., transmission service, air suspension strut replacement) can easily range from $1,500 to $4,000+ depending on the model and specific repair.
